For Outlook/Hotmail on Windows, the supported setting is to make Windows keep scroll bars visible:
- Open Start > Settings.
- Go to Ease of Access > Display.
- Turn Automatically hide scroll bars in Windows to Off.
If the scroll bar is still missing in Outlook, restore the app window:
- Right-click the Outlook title bar.
- Select Maximize.
- Right-click the title bar again.
- Select Restore.
If the issue is specifically in Outlook 2016 and the view jumps or scrolling behaves incorrectly, Microsoft lists it as a known issue that was fixed in certain builds. For Current Channel, a registry-based workaround exists. Warning: editing the registry can cause system problems if done incorrectly.
